**P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ES**

The Government Affairs Associate will be responsible for enhancing relationships between both the Toronto Regional Real Estate Board (TRREB) and the Ontario Real Estate Association (OREA) and relevant Members of Provincial Parliament (MPPs), municipal politicians and other decision-makers, such as local city planners, who play a role in housing policy outcomes. Additionally, in this role you will also nurture relationships with TRREB brokerage ambassadors, to enhance Member communications related to relevant government policies impacting real estate.

The incumbent will be required to service all of TRREB's jurisdictional areas, including Toronto, York Region, Brampton, and Simcoe County, as well as partner board areas of Durham, Peel, Halton, Northumberland, and Quinte regions.

Positioning TRREB and OREA's membership as champions of housing and real estate and leveraging policy outcomes that advance and benefit objectives and activities that impact the TRREB and/or OREA memberships, home owners, renters, landlords and businesses is an important requirement of the position.

**PRINCIPAL DUTIES**
- Monitor and keep up-to-date on issues related to housing, real estate and any other matters that are of potential interest to TRREB and OREA that may arise in the municipal, provincial, and federal arenas as identified by TRREB.
- Build and maintain high-valued relationships with municipal and other decision-makers that impact housing in Toronto, Brampton, York Region, Simcoe County, and partner board jurisdictions of Durham, Peel, Halton, Northumberland, and Quinte. This will include arranging for meetings between TRREB and/or OREA and decision-makers, preparing materials in advance of the meetings, and following through on next steps as required.
- Develop and manage relationships with GTA MPPs including the Premier, relevant ministers, opposition critics and party leaders. This will include arranging for meetings between TRREB and/or OREA and decision-makers, preparing materials in advance of these meetings, and following through on next steps as required.
- Attend and observe municipal Council and committee meetings, as well as provincial and federal legislative meetings, to identify and track public policy initiatives relevant to TRREB and OREA interests. In-person and/or virtual attendance will be required as appropriate.
- Track other government related events and initiatives such as public meetings and information sessions, in which issues relevant to TRREB and OREA are raised.
- Develop relationships with elected representatives and staff, through ongoing attendance at government and public policy events.
- Engage with all TRREB brokerage ambassadors to keep them updated of current government affairs issues that TRREB is working on.
- Schedule virtual or in-person meetings with brokerages, so that TRREB Government Relations staff can present relevant policy and legislative initiatives impacting Members' trade in real estate.
- Brief other TRREB Government Relations staff and OREA representatives on the status of relevant municipal, provincial, and federal government initiatives.
- Prepare written summaries and briefing notes on the status of relevant municipal, provincial, and federal government initiatives.
- Adhere to acceptable practices and all Lobbyist Codes of Conduct and legal requirements.
- Ensure that TRREB lobbyist registrations are updated with any communications/lobbying with public office holders.
- Work with the GR Team on the development and implementation of a GR strategy and engagement plan.
- Develop and update fact sheets on government programs.
- Assist with the preparation of articles and news releases for publication in various TRREB, OREA and other external channels.
- Identify and arrange opportunities for government officials to participate in TRREB and OREA events, including providing on-site assistance at other TRREB special events, as required.
- Perform other duties as assigned from time to time.

**HEALTH AND SAFETY RESPONSIBILITIES**

The incumbent will follow safe work procedures, knowing and complying with all health and safety regulations. Personal protection and safety equipment will be used if/when required. Any injury or illness, unsafe acts or unsafe conditions must be reported immediately to their supervisor.

**REQUIREMENTS**

**Education**:

- Post-secondary degree in political science, public administration, public relations, or related field.

**Experience**:

- Minimum 3 years of experience working in a relationship management role with a focus on government policy related to housing, commercial real estate, economic development, economics, urban planning, or other fields related to TRREB interests.
- Experience working in a professional association preferred.
- Sound knowledge of government a must.
- Knowledge of lobbyist registry requirements and lobbyist codes of conduct.
- Knowledge of the real estate industry is desirable.
